This is my game so far. Its a work in progress.
The problem is the the gun gets cut off when the arm rotates. I dont really know how to fix this.

I think the arm is cut off because you're drawing it after the body. Try Pic.SetTransparentColor (color) for each image. picMerge does nothing without setting the invisible color (unless you did that and I didn't see it...)

Thanks for the help im still having problems though. I did a Set.TransparentColor on the character but it didnt work. Also the arm and gun have to be set after the character or they will appear behind him...

EDIT: I fixed the problem. All I had to do is increase the canvas size of the gun and arm by a large amount...
